1

Preheat

Preheat air fryer to 180°C (350°F).

2

Air fry

Place frozen garlic bread slices in the basket in a single layer, butter-side up. Cook for 5-6 minutes until golden and crispy around the edges.

3

Garnish and serve

Sprinkle with Parmesan and parsley if desired. Serve immediately.

Pro Tips

  • Check at the 4-minute mark as smaller or thinner slices may cook faster.
  • For extra indulgence, add a sprinkle of mozzarella in the last 2 minutes of cooking.
